André Gustav Citroën was born on February 5, 1878 in Paris and as a result of his father's suicide he was forced to work at a very young age in the family gemstone business. During his youth he became interested in the avant-garde work of Jules Verne and was introduced to engineering during the construction process of the Eiffel Tower. At the age of 22, he graduated as an engineer from the Ecole Polytechnique de Paris dedication and first developed his profession working in a gear factory.
